Now hiring

Senior Technical Lead @ Infinite Computer Solutions

Bangalore - CampusOnsiteFull-timePosted 6 days ago

Opens on the employer's site

About this role

JOB DESCRIPTION · INFRASTRUCTURE AUTOMATION · TECHNICAL LEADERSHIP Technical Lead Automation Terraform · Ansible · ServiceNow Dev Infrastructure-as-Code CI/CD Pipelines Python / Bash GitOps Ansible AAP Terraform Cloud ServiceNow ITSM/ITOM Kubernetes Infrastructure / DevOps / Automation Department Head of Infrastructure / CTO Reports To Full-Time Employment 7–12 Years Experience 3–8 Automation Engineers Team Lead POSITION OVERVIEW We are looking for an experienced and technically exceptional Technical Lead – Automation to own our infrastructure automation practice and lead a team of automation engineers. This role sits at the intersection of infrastructure engineering, platform development, and DevOps — responsible for designing, building, and governing the frameworks that automate our entire IT estate: provisioning, configuration management, patching, compliance, and self-healing operations. The ideal candidate brings deep, battle-tested expertise in Terraform (Infrastructure-as-Code) and Ansible (configuration management and automation), combined with strong scripting skills in Python and Bash, and meaningful exposure to ServiceNow development — particularly integrating Ansible Automation Platform and Terraform workflows into ServiceNow ITSM/ITOM for closed-loop, event-driven, and catalogue-triggered automation. You will lead by example — writing production-quality code, setting engineering standards, mentoring the team, and driving automation-first culture across the organisation. THREE CORE AUTOMATION PILLARS ️ Terraform Infrastructure-as-Code Multi-cloud IaC (AWS / Azure / GCP) Terraform Cloud / Enterprise Module library design & governance State management & remote backends Workspace & environment strategy Terratest automated testing Sentinel / OPA policy-as-code Drift detection & remediation Ansible Configuration & Automation Ansible Automation Platform (AAP) Playbook & role development Dynamic inventory (cloud / CMDB) Molecule testing framework Event-Driven Ansible (EDA) AAP job templates & workflows AWX / Ansible Galaxy / Hub RHEL / Linux config management ️ ServiceNow Dev ITSM / ITOM Integration Flow Designer & Integration Hub Ansible & Terraform spoke config ITSM-triggered automation flows ITOM Orchestration runbooks CMDB-driven dynamic inventory Service Catalogue provisioning GlideScript scripting exposure REST API / MID Server integration AUTOMATION DELIVERY LIFECYCLE 0 Phase 1 Design & Plan Automation scope mapping IaC module architecture Ansible role structure design SNOW integration design Toolchain selection Infrastructure / DevOps / Automation Department Phase 3 Test & Validate Terratest framework testing Molecule role testing Integration pipeline gates ATF ServiceNow testing Drift & compliance checks Phase 4 Deploy & Operate GitOps production rollout AAP job template execution SNOW catalogue publishing EDA event-driven triggers Observability & alerting HOW SUCCESS IS MEASURED 3 Infrastructure / DevOps / Automation Department Mean time to provision new infrastructure Zero Configuration drift in managed estate 100% IaC coverage of new infra deployments KEY RESPONSIBILITIES ️ Terraform – Infrastructure-as-Code Leadership Architect and maintain the enterprise Terraform module library — reusable, versioned, and tested modules for compute, networking, storage, identity, and security resources across AWS, Azure, and on-premises environments. Define and enforce Terraform workspace and environment strategy — managing dev, staging, and production state isolation, remote backend configuration (S3 / Azure Blob / Terraform Cloud), and state locking. Implement Terraform Cloud / Enterprise workspaces — configuring VCS-driven runs, remote execution, team access controls, and policy enforcement using Sentinel or Open Policy Agent (OPA). Lead Terraform code quality governance — mandatory peer review, automated linting (tflint, checkov), security scanning, and Terratest test coverage gates in CI/CD pipelines. Design and implement Terraform drift detection workflows — scheduled plan-only runs, drift alerting to ServiceNow incidents, and automated remediation via Ansible for configuration variance. Develop and maintain Terraform provider integrations for Cisco infrastructure, VMware vSphere, Nutanix, Cohesity, and cloud-native services beyond standard HashiCorp providers. Mentor the team on Terraform best practices — DRY module design, variable hierarchy, locals vs. variables, lifecycle meta-arguments, and managing complex resource dependencies. Ansible – Configuration Management & Automation Platform Design, develop, and maintain enterprise Ansible roles and collections following Ansible best practices — idempotency, handler usage, tag strategy, variable precedence, and Jinja2 templating. Own and administer Ansible Automation Platform (AAP) — configuring job templates, workflow job templates, inventories, credentials, RBAC policies, and notification integrations. Implement Event-Driven Ansible (EDA) rulebook configurations — triggering automated remediation, compliance enforcement, and patching workflows from ServiceNow events, monitoring alerts, and webhook sources. Build and maintain dynamic inventory plugins integrating Ansible with Terraform state files, ServiceNow CMDB, AWS EC2, Azure Resource Manager, VMware vCenter, and Nutanix Prism Central. Lead the Linux patching automation programme — scheduling, rolling update strategies, pre/post validation playbooks, rollback logic, and integration with Red Hat Satellite for RHEL lifecycle management. Develop Molecule test scenarios for all Ansible roles — Docker and Vagrant drivers, assert-based verification, and integration with CI/

Ready to apply?

Install the ResuMinder extension and we'll auto-fill the application in seconds — no rewriting.

Get the extension →
See how your CV scores — free
Senior Technical Lead at Infinite Computer Solutions | ResuMinder Jobs